Exterior Painting McKinney: Best Season and Cost Guide
Exterior painting McKinney contractors recommend scheduling in spring or fall, when temperatures stay in the ideal 50 to 85 degree range for paint curing. Summer heat above 95 to 100 degrees and winter cold snaps both make exterior painting riskier. This guide covers pricing, HOA rules, and historic district considerations for 2026.

Cost ranges by home size and story count
A single-story exterior repaint in McKinney typically runs $4,500 to $8,500, while two-story homes common in newer Craig Ranch and Trinity Falls phases run $6,500 to $12,000 due to added surface area and ladder or lift work.
Stucco exteriors, common in parts of Adriatica, may cost more to prep than fiber cement siding because cracks need patching before painting.
Why timing matters so much in North Texas
McKinney summers regularly hit 95 to 100 degrees, which can cause latex paint to dry too fast on sun-exposed walls, leading to lap marks and poor adhesion.
Spring and fall offer more stable humidity and temperature, giving paint the time it needs to cure properly before the next rain or heat spike.
HOA and historic district approval
Master-planned communities including Stonebridge Ranch and Craig Ranch generally require HOA architectural committee approval of exterior color changes before work begins.
Homes inside the Historic Neighborhood Improvement Zone near Historic Downtown McKinney need a Certificate of Appropriateness from the city's Historic Preservation office for exterior color changes.
Dealing with clay soil related trim damage
Expansive North Texas clay soil causes seasonal ground movement that can crack caulk joints between trim, siding, and masonry, so a good exterior repaint should include re-caulking these joints first.
Skipping this step is a common reason exterior paint jobs fail early in McKinney, since new paint over cracked caulk will crack again within a season or two.
Typical cost ranges
| Single-story exterior repaint | $4,500-$8,500 |
| Two-story exterior repaint | $6,500-$12,000 |
| Trim and door repaint only | $900-$2,200 |
Ranges are general estimates gathered from homeowner-reported quotes, not an offer or a quote for your project.
Common questions
What is the best month to paint a house exterior in McKinney?
April, May, September, and October tend to offer the most stable temperatures and lowest rain risk for exterior painting.
Does my HOA need to approve my exterior paint color?
Most master-planned McKinney communities like Stonebridge Ranch and Craig Ranch require HOA approval of exterior color changes separate from any city requirement.
Do I need city approval to repaint in Historic Downtown McKinney?
Yes, homes in the Historic Neighborhood Improvement Zone need a Certificate of Appropriateness from the city's Historic Preservation office before changing exterior colors.
